Frage

Was sind meine Optionen? Ich habe versucht, MonoDevelop vor über einem Jahr, aber es war sehr buggy. Ist die neueste Version eine stabile Entwicklungsumgebung?

War es hilfreich?

Lösung

MonoDevelop 2.0 wird veröffentlicht, es hat jetzt einen anständigen GUI-Debugger, Code-Vervollständigung, Intellisense C # 3.0-Unterstützung (einschließlich Linq) und einem anständigen GTK # Visuellen Designer.

Kurz gesagt, seit der Version 2.0 Ich habe begonnen, wieder mit Mono entwickeln und ist sehr glücklich mit ihm so weit.

Überprüfen Sie die MonoDevelop Website für weitere Informationen aus.

Andere Tipps

Microsoft hat Visual Studio-Code für Linux, die eine gute C # Unterstützung hat, natürlich.

Monodevelop
Es gibt zwei Versionen um:

  • 1.0: die aktuell stabile Version. Es ist in der Tat stabil, aber etwas in seinen Fähigkeiten begrenzt. Es ist sehr gut für kleinere Projekte. Ich habe es über die ubuntu hardy repos.

  • 2.0RC (aka 1.9.x) Sie können es über SVN und Compilierung zu bekommen. Der Prozess ist sehr einfach, und man kann es laufen, ohne (via make run) zu installieren. Es ist etwas weniger stabil als 1,0, aber es hängt davon ab, welcher bauen Sie (es ist ein Entwicklungs-Schnappschuss) erhalten. In Bezug auf Fähigkeiten, ist es großartig. Es hat Refactoring, Profilieren, Tonnen von Plugins etc.

Ich würde empfehlen, X-Entwicklung von Omnicore . Es ist eine sehr gute IDE, ist aber nur 30 Tage lang kostenlos nutzen.

Es ist ein C # für Eclipse-Bindung, obwohl ich es nicht persönlich versucht habe, so kann ich es nicht bürgen. Ich benutze MonoDevelop, die nicht perfekt ist, aber funktioniert recht gut für den größten Teil. Die Version, die in Ubuntu 8.04 (Hardy Heron) ist viel stabiler als die Gutsy Gibbon-Version.

Ich habe mit JetBrains Reiter für eine ganze Weile und ich mag es sehr.

Es hat all die ReSharper Güte und ist eine Freude, auf O / X oder Linux zu verwenden. Beachten Sie, dass es noch in Early Access Programm ist, so hat es ein paar Ecken und Kanten gibt und da, aber die meiste Zeit funktioniert es gut genug für Tag-zu-Tag-Nutzung.

Sie können es hier: https://www.jetbrains.com/rider/download/

P. S. Ich benutze es vor allem für .NET Core-Entwicklung braucht, haben aber für traditionelle .NET-Codierung als auch verwendet werden.

Früher habe ich MonoDevelop eine Weile her, und es war in Ordnung. Es ist überall nicht annähernd so gut wie Eclipse oder NetBeans für Java-Entwicklung ist, aber das ist wirklich in einer Klasse für sie. Und ich denke, dass die einzige wirkliche Alternative ist emacs oder vim ...

Es ist ziemlich poliert. Stabilität war wirklich kein Problem. Einfache Code-Completion ist es, wie zu springen zu Erklärung, super-Klasse und die extrem nützlich finden Referenzen. Debugging ist nicht da, obwohl, das ist ein ziemlich eklatantes Versäumnis ist. Ich habe tatsächlich ein paar Minuten, um einen Haltepunkt einzurichten versuchen, bis es dämmerte mir, dass es nicht einmal ein Weg zu „Debug ...“ statt „Ausführen ...“

Haben Sie sich unter SlickEdit ? Ich dachte, es vor einigen Jahren ziemlich gut war, als ich die Entwicklung C ++ Anwendungen auf Linux. Er sagt, es C # unterstützt, aber ich kann, wie gut nicht kommentieren. Ich war froh, dass es für die Entwicklung meiner C ++ zu verwenden, though.

  

Ist die neueste Version stabil eine stabile Entwicklungsumgebung?

Wahrscheinlich ... es traf 1.0 im Frühjahr dieses Jahres.

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top